Latest Patents

One of his latest patents is titled "Systems and methods for vacant property identification and display." This invention provides a location matching method that involves receiving photos of vacant properties and their surroundings. The method processes these photos to extract relevant features, generates descriptive tags, and recommends properties based on user preferences. Another notable patent is for "Dynamic vehicle tags," which includes a system for displaying information on a vehicle's exterior. This system authenticates requests to show information, monitors for misuse, and flags any inappropriate use of displayed data.
